Wentorf bei Hamburg is a residential municipality located in the Herzogtum Lauenburg district, distinguished by its proximity to the expansive Sachsenwald forest. While the town serves as a quiet transition between the Hamburg metropolitan area and rural Schleswig-Holstein, it offers access to historical landmarks like Schloss Reinbek. Visitors can enjoy local nature walks through the Dalbekschlucht or visit the nearby Bergedorfer Mühle for a glimpse into regional agricultural heritage. The area is defined by a blend of historical architecture and modern residential infrastructure, maintaining strong logistical ties to the neighboring Bergedorf district.
